Affordable Housing Barriers Transparency Act

To amend the Department of Housing and Urban Development Act to require that the annual report of the Department of Housing and Urban Development include an identification of significant regulatory barriers to affordable housing.

Introduced Feb 17, 2026

Latest action (Feb 17, 2026) Referred to the House Committee on Financial Services.

Summary

This bill requires the Department of Housing and Urban Development to include in its annual report an identification of significant regulatory barriers to affordable housing. The report must also include a discussion and analysis of how to reduce or remove these barriers. The bill amends Section 8 of the Department of Housing and Urban Development Act to establish this reporting requirement, using the definition of regulatory barriers established in the Housing and Community Development Act of 1992.

Full text

IN THE HOUSE OF REPRESENTATIVES

February 17, 2026

Mr. Lawler introduced the following bill; which was referred to the Committee on Financial Services

A BILL

To amend the Department of Housing and Urban Development Act to require that the annual report of the Department of Housing and Urban Development include an identification of significant regulatory barriers to affordable housing.

SECTION 1. SHORT TITLE.

This Act may be cited as the “Affordable Housing Barriers Transparency Act”.

SEC. 2. IDENTIFICATION OF REGULATORY BARRIERS TO AFFORDABLE HOUSING IN HUD ANNUAL REPORT.

Section 8 of the Department of Housing and Urban Development Act (42 U.S.C. 3536) is amended by adding at the end the following: “Each such annual report shall include an identification of significant regulatory barriers to affordable housing, within the meaning of such term as provided in the first sentence of section 1203 of the Housing and Community Development Act of 1992 (42 U.S.C. 12705b), and a discussion and analysis of how to reduce or remove such barriers.”. <all>
